Titan Amanda TEC (Thermal Electronic Chip) Cooler Review

 

"The Titan Amanda TEC is a tower-design cooler with four heat pipes and two fans for taking air in and exhausting it.

 

The first pair of heat pipes takes heat off the bottom plate of the copper base which is nickel-plated to prevent corrosion (quoting the manufacturer). Next goes a 60W Peltier element that pumps heat up from its bottom to top, above which another nickel-plated copper plate is located.

 

Two more heat pipes take heat away from the top plate. The plates are fastened together with four spring-loaded screws. You can see traces of thermal grease along their edges. Judging by the color and consistence, it is Titan TTG-G30010 thermal grease which you’ll find included with your Amanda.

I have wanted to do this project for a few years now. While it’s was a relatively quick build, the time from the photo shoot to publish has been an extremely long and rocky road. Regardless in the end we have produced the first ionic cooling system for your high end gaming system. This system produces absolutely no noise and in fact has no moving parts at all. While this is a proof of concept it proves that you can get the CFM you need to cool a system efficiently with no moving parts and no increase in power consumption.
